Fujitsu today announced the development of speech interface technology that enables users to retrieve a variety of information by simply speaking into a smartphone, without having to look at the smartphone’s display. After listening to a synthesized speech read the latest news and other information, users in Japan can articulate the information that they would like to learn more about. The software will then read details about the topic and other related information.
By taking advantage of this technology, users who are driving or working and need to keep their eyes and hands free can use various information services without having to look at or touch the smartphone’s display.
